I saw the new Nike catalog and here is the low down

They will be releasing a totally new boot the Tiempo Ronaldinho. It will be priced at 150.00. The upper is K-Leather and it will only be offered in a black with white trim. The design is very retro, the nike tick looks like the one from the late 1970's. The outsole is a round stud and blade hybrid like the current AZT's. There are some pics floating around on a www.bootnr.com thread of an early production smaple of these boots titled the super legend. They are basiclly the same with a little bit different tounge. FG and SG will be offered

The AZT's will come on a Red with grey and white trim and the other model will be a Black with red and white trim (picture the current Rooney colorway and then reverse the colors). The Black will come in SG as well as FG.

The Vapor will have a new R9 color way which is a really odd shade of metalic dark blue, its not quite navy but not quite purple either. Then there is a White model with a Black tick and Sliver on the heal. Nike really didn't do too much with these colors. The white looks like every other white Vapor that is out now.

The Legend will stick around but be limited to the Black color way and a new White colorway with Black trim. The White was avaliable on Nike ID. for a while.

The Brasilian will be replaced with a mock up of the new Ronaldinho boots, I can't recall the name of these but is had Brasil something or another in the title.

The indoor/sala line is just adding new colors to the new boots that will be coming out this fall which are the new AirZoom Control(aside from the fact that the lime green color dropping this fall is awful, this will be one of the top two indoor boots of the season) and First Touch models. There was a minor error on my part the R9 Vapor isn't really dark blue, I got a more solid look at the catalog today and it is more like a chrome with blue tint and neon yellow on the heel.

They are close to the Chrome and Lime Vapor's in color but like I said the the chrome has a blueish tint.

The indoor models are the Air Zoom Control 2 in a turf style bottom and a flat the turf is white and the flat is marron and red. The other is the First Touch, the turf bottom model is navy blue and the flat is white and yellow.

Both these indoors look great, Nike has give the Controls a proper tounge and an external heel counter they have a KNG-75 upper and the First Touch has a lower quality synthetic called Trophy which is used on the current Steam model shoes. They don't feature Zoom Air or the heel counter but they also look very nice.
